Unidentified and Incomplete Testimony of Unnamed Person about Murder of Terrel, 1797 - 1897
Description
Unidentified and incomplete testimony of unnamed person about murder of Terrel. Ragsdale, Edward Nickel, Downing, Grimmit, and Ross are mentioned. One sheet of paper with handwritten text in ink on recto and verso. Folder 1393
